What is MATIC and why do you need it?
MATIC is the native asset of the Polygon blockchain and it's used to pay for transaction fees, secure the network and vote on governance issues on Polygon. That's just a quick overview and if you want to learn more about MATIC and Polygon I strongly recommend checking this great guide by the @crypto-guides initiative.
You can use MATIC to pool it on the farms available on PolyCUB and, ultimately, you will need it to pay for any transaction fees you do there so if you want to have any involvement in PolyCUB whatsoever, you will 100% need some MATIC.
Setting things up
Buying MATIC with HIVE is quite easy but there are some things you will need to make it work.
The first thing you will need is a wallet connected to the Polygon Network. I believe Metamask, which is what I use, is one of the most popular options but there are others.
For the purposes of this article, I will assume that you already have your wallet connected and ready to go but, if not, @finguru made this great guide on how to setup Metamask with the Polygon Network.
The other thing you will need is some liquid HIVE on your HIVE wallet or SWAP.HIVE on Hive-Engine.
Buying MATIC with HIVE
We will be using TribalDex for this, which is a Hive-Engine app so if you never used it before, all you need is to connect with your Hive account and you're set.
The first thing we need to do is deposit out liquid HIVE to get some SWAP.HIVE. If you already have SWAP.HIVE you can skip this bit.
To keep things simple, I'll just do the deposit right here on TribalDex but feel free to use your preferred dex to do so.
Okay, so, click on the wallet icon on the top right corner of the screen, next to your username, and then click on Deposit.

Another window will popup and ask you to choose a token. Choose HIVE, type in the amount you want to deposit and click on Deposit HIVE

Now we have the SWAP.HIVE we need to actually get the SWAP.MATIC we need.
Click on Exchange on the top menu and then, on the picklist to the left, type in MATIC. The only hit you will get will be SWAP.MATIC which is what we're looking for, so click that.
Scroll down a bit and you will find the fields to do the swap. You can place an order or, if you prefer, you can buy at market price by clicking on the MARKET button and typing in the amount of SWAP.HIVE you want to spend. Click on buy and now you got yourself some MATIC!
Getting your MATIC to Polygon
There is one last step you need to do before you're able to interact with PolyCUB, which is getting your MATIC (or SWAP.MATIC at this point) from Hive-Engine to the Polygon network.
This is where you will need your Polygon wallet.
Click on the wallet icon again but this time, instead of clicking on Deposit we'll click on Withdraw. You will be asked to select the token you want to withdraw. Make sure you choose Polygon (MATIC). Then, choose the amount you want to withdraw, paste your Polygon address and click on Withdraw SWAP.MATIC.
Now you're all set! In a few seconds, you should see your newly bought MATIC on your Polygon wallet. You're ready to rock on PolyCUB!
Final considerations
There are a few things to keep in mind regarding this process:
- There are some fees involved in the deposit and withdrawal process. While they are minor (less than 1%) keep them in mind while planning how much you want to move around.
- While buying MATIC directly on Hive can be very convenient, make sure to check how much you're paying for MATIC on here and compare that to other options to make sure you're getting the best bang for your buck.
- If you follow this guide step by step it's not likely that you will encounter any issues but I still recommend you do a test run first with a small amount to make sure you got it. You will have to pay the fees for this test run but that's better than losing a significant amount of assets due to a mistake
